Eldon tops Blair Oaks in baseball

ELDON, Mo. - Drew Rodriguez tossed a four-hitter Friday in leading the Eldon Mustangs to a 2-0 victory against the Blair Oaks Falcons.

Rodriguez, a freshman, walked one and struck out nine in going the distance in the seven-inning game. All four of Blair Oaks' hits were singles.

Eldon, which had seven hits, scored single runs in the first and sixth innings. Cory Hohman and Jeremy Hartwick had two hits each for the Mustangs.

Alec Sieg took the loss for the Falcons, working the first 11/3 innings. He allowed a run on a hit and four walks while recording one strikeout. Austin Herrigon pitched the next 22/3 nnings, allowing two hits and a walk. He also had one strikeout. James Reinkemeyer pitched the final two innings, giving up a run on four hits. He struck out two.

Blair Oaks (3-1) will return to action today with games against Holden and Cuba in Cuba.
